DACban
DACban is a digital asset compliance banking platform designed to facilitate secure and regulated transactions for cryptocurrency holders. The project was launched in 2019 by a consortium of fintech engineers and legal experts in Singapore, with the aim of bridging the gap between traditional banking services and the rapidly evolving digital asset ecosystem. Its core value proposition centers on providing a regulated custodial wallet coupled with automated transaction monitoring, ensuring that all transfers meet anti‑money laundering (AML) and know‑your‑customer (KYC) requirements.
